We're united by a shared commitment to excellent and equitable health care.Position Overview
Provides program support under the direction of Director Programs and Patient Services.
Demonstrates ability to provide continuous quality services.
Working in a confidential capacity, provides support to the Director Programs and Patient Services for all matters pertaining to program.
General office routine: collects and routes mail and interoffice correspondence, photocopying, filing, etc.
Initiates appropriate requisitions for Departmental supplies not on carousel, equipment and maintenance repairs and capital equipment purchases.
Participates in current professional groups, reading and attendance at workshops and seminars related to position.
Experience
A minimum of one year of experience in the health care field required.
Demonstrated proficiency in all Microsoft Office applications.
Education (Degree/Diploma/Certificate)
Completion of a recognized Medical Secretarial Course required.
Certification/Licensure/RegistrationNot ApplicableQualifications and Skills
Demonstrated strong listening, verbal and written communication skills, complemented by good problem-solving skills required.
Demonstrated experience in organizing and coordinating multiple projects concurrently required.
The ability to perform the position on a regular basis.
